• The If Clause Type II has the following pattern:
• If + Simple Past, Conditional I (would)

• The condition is located in the “if” part of the sentence.
• If + Simple Past (Condition), Conditional I(action)

It is possible, but very unlikely that the condition is fulfilled in Clause Type 2 situations.

• Example:
• If I made extra money, I would fly to Colorado.

• If I made extra money, I would fly to Colorado.
• Meaning – If it is possible though very unlikely that I made extra money (the condition), I would fly to Colorado (action).

• The sentence does not have to begin with IF.
• I would fly to Colorado If I made extra money.
